Fossil Study Shows how T. Rex Became King

The remains of a new species of horse-sized dinosaur reveal how Tyrannosaurus rex became one of Earth’s top predators, a study suggests. The discovery unearthed in Uzbekistan provides key insights into how a family of small-bodied dinosaurs evolved over millions of years to become fearsome giants. Stroke Risk Reduced if Brain Blood Vessel Disorder is Left Alone

By University of Edinburgh on Apr 29, 2014   Breaking News, Health  

Treating patients who suffer from a common condition that affects blood vessels in the brain increases their risk of stroke, a study has found.
